Voices of Greenwood: Conversation with Carlos Moreno and Jennifer King

Event Details

Join Carlos Moreno, from The Victory of Greenwood, and Jennifer King, the grand-niece of the Race Massacre of 1921’s survivors Mabel and Pressley Little, as they discuss Pressley Little’s family and legacy. Moreno and King will also talk about Susie Bell, sister of Pressley Little and successful restauranteur before the riots, and her passion for learning about her family ancestry.
